加密货币背后的密码:深
2025-03-25
在数字技术飞速发展的今天,加密货币已经成为一个热门话题。比特币、以太坊和其他数百种加密货币几乎每天都在新闻中出现,它们的价格波动、市场趋势和投资机会时时吸引着投资者和普通用户的关注。然而,许多人对加密货币背后的技术细节知之甚少,尤其是加密货币是如何工作的,这就需要我们深入探索其背后的“密码”。
本文将详细介绍加密货币背后的密码,重点探讨区块链技术、加密算法及其安全性。我们将回答以下五个相关
加密货币在保证交易安全性方面的机制主要体现在其底层的区块链技术和复杂的加密算法。首先,区块链是由一系列按时间顺序链接的区块组成的,每一个区块包含了若干交易信息。每当一个新的交易被生成后,它会被广播到整个网络,并由网络中的节点(即计算机)共同确认其有效性。
此次确认过程使用了像SHA-256这样的哈希函数来确保数据的完整性和不可篡改性。每个区块中包含前一个区块的哈希值,这种加密方式确保一个区块一旦被添加到区块链中,就无法更改它的内容,因为更改任何数据都会导致该区块的哈希变化,从而失去与后续区块的链接。
此外,加密货币使用了公钥和私钥相结合的方式来保障交易的安全性。每个用户都会形成一对密钥:公钥可以让其他人向你发送加密货币,而私钥则用来签名交易。只有拥有私钥的人才能对发送的交易进行确认,从而有效防止盗窃和伪造。
这两个机制结合使得加密货币的交易在公平性和透明度上得以保证,根本上消除了传统金融体系中由于中心化导致的信任问题。所有交易都记录在区块链上,任何人都有权随时查阅,确保了其不可更改性和公开性。
区块链技术的核心原理在于通过分布式账本技术和智能合约来实现去中心化的交易记录和资产转移。区块链的工作机制可以分为以下几个重要方面:
首先,区块链是一个分布式的数据库,广泛分布在网络中(通常为数百甚至数千台服务器),这使得每个参与者(节点)都可以同时访问和更新数据。在传统中心化系统中,数据往往存储在单一地点,容易受到攻击或数据丢失的威胁。而在区块链中,即使某一台服务器宕机或被攻击,其他节点仍可以继续验证和保存整个系统的数据。
其次,区块链使用块链(blockchain)将多个交易数据打包到一个区块中,利用复杂的加密算法和共识机制(例如工作量证明(PoW)或权益证明(PoS))确认每个块的有效性。在这种机制下,区块链节点需要共同达成一致,确认交易的合法性,这有效地降低了中心化管理带来的风险。
最后,区块链中的智能合约则可以自动执行一些预定条件下的合约条款——一旦触发,合约将会自动履行。这种机制使得交易过程更加高效,降低了人为干预的可能性。
通过这些核心原理,区块链技术可以构建出一个透明、开放以及高效的数字生态系统,为各种应用场景(如金融、物流、医疗)提供了基础。
中心化和去中心化是区块链技术与传统金融体系之间的核心区别。在中心化系统中,某个服务器(或管理机构)控制着整个网络中的数据,便于快速访问和管理,但也使得该系统暴露在某些特定风险之下。
中心化的典型例子就是银行管理账户,客户将资金存入银行,银行记录所有交易,客户端不得不信任银行的管理,依赖于其安全性和透明度。然而这也导致了许多问题,例如数据隐私泄露、账户被封等。
而去中心化系统则意味着没有单独的控制中心,数据和交易记录是双色球分布在全球多个节点上,所有参与者都有权访问和验证。这样的设计消除了对中心化管理信任的需求,因为每个人都可以检查和确认交易的合法性。
去中心化还意味着更高的安全性,因为即使某个节点受到攻击,整个网络仍然能够正常运行,信息也不会受到破坏。这种信任机制使得去中心化金融(DeFi)等新兴业务得以发展,赋予用户更多的自主权。
加密货币的挖矿是指通过计算机运算来解决复杂的数学问题,以验证交易并将其添加到区块链中的过程。这一过程需要计算大量的复杂运算,通常需要消耗大量的计算资源和电力。
以比特币为例,挖矿的过程首先是挖矿者(矿工)收集网络中尚未验证的交易,并将其打包成一个区块。然后,通过计算复杂的哈希函数,矿工会尝试找到一个符合系统要求的数值(称为“难度目标”)。该过程被称为“工作量证明”。只有成功找到符合要求的哈希值,矿工才能将自己的区块添加到链中,并收获相应的比特币奖励。
挖矿带来的不仅仅是新币的产生,还确保了网络中交易的安全性。通过完成挖矿,矿工们共同维护着整个网络的安全性,防止网络攻击和恶意行为。
然而,随着算力的提升和比特币的数量有限,挖矿的难度也在不断增加,这导致很多小型矿工难以参与竞争,造成越来越多资源集中在大矿池手中。虽然挖矿本身激励了许多参与者的加入,但也面临着中心化的趋势。此外,大量的能源消耗也引起了人们的关注,如何实现环保挖矿成为未来重要的发展方向。
未来加密货币的发展趋势前景广泛而复杂,可能受到多种因素的影响,包括技术进步、监管政策、市场需求等。
首先,技术方面的创新将推动加密货币的发展。Layer 2解决方案的引入,诸如闪电网络(Lightning Network)将提升区块链的交易速度和降低费用。同时,跨链技术的发展将进一步改善不同加密货币之间的合作和流通性,使得用户更方便地在不同平台间进行交易。
其次,随着用户需求的增加,更多企业和平台将会采用加密货币作为支付手段。无论是互联网公司,还是传统零售商,都会逐步认识到数字资产的潜力。未来我们可能会见到更多的商家接受加密货币,并扩展其应用范围。
监管政策也将大大影响未来趋势。随着加密市场的不断壮大,各国政府都在积极考虑如何监管这一领域。较为明确的监管政策将有助于吸引更多的投资者进入市场,提供安全保障,但也可能打击一些非法交易和运营。因此,如何平衡监管与促进创新,成为了全球各国需要共同面对的挑战。
总之,加密货币的未来充满想象空间,但无论如何,要实现可持续发展的目标,需依赖于技术的进步与政策的导向。一个开放、安全、透明的加密生态系统将会逐渐形成,带来更多的创新与机会。
本文对加密货币背后的密码进行了详细探讨,希望能为读者提供有价值的启示。随着这一领域的不断发展,保持关注和学习将有助于在未来的数字经济中把握住更多机会。